A stockbroker is an expert individual that is educated and licensed to take part in stock market. A stockbroker usually act as an agent in the market, he will stand in between the client and the vendor and acquire a fee for his personal service in the transaction. He at all times guarantee he provide priceless service and data that might help the investor in making an accurate and adequate investment decision. Whereas a university diploma just isn’t strictly essential, many companies require one for stockbroker applicants.

This is in order that you know the way to cope with figures as you encounter it in your day by day operations as a stockbroker. To make it as a successful stockbroker, you’ll need to turnkey forex solutions in India work lengthy hours, especially initially, when you’re building your pipeline or listing of purchasers. The job consists of giving shoppers advice and requires a robust ability to sell, since you will earn your pay through commissions. Stockbrokers buy and sell shares on the direction of their purchasers. Being a stockbroker requires sales and social abilities since these professionals are responsible for constructing and advising their very own consumer base. Some shoppers may not be familiar with the market, so it’s as much as the broker to assess the state of affairs and explain their suggestions merely. If you want to turn into a stockbroker, the first step is to earn a school diploma. A bachelor’s degree is required for many entry-level positions, and it’s especially useful to major in something business-related. These classes provide an overview of the industry and can help hone your expertise in finance and economics. Becoming a stock broker typically takes a quantity of years of schooling and expertise.

The expected rate of job growth for stockbrokers is 6 percent, with an estimated 23,300 new jobs to be created from 2016 to 2026, in accordance with the BLS. “An getting older population and the decline of traditional pensions may boost demand for these workers, as individuals approaching retirement search brokers to facilitate securities purchases,” based on the BLS. Nevertheless, the job security for a stockbroker is closely tied to the well being of the monetary business. The BLS notes that consolidation in the monetary providers business, in addition to the elevated automation of certain inventory purchases, could sluggish hiring. “Financial corporations will focus on hiring sales brokers with specialized areas of experience and strong customer-service expertise,” in accordance with the BLS. Inventory brokers can probably make good money, but it is dependent upon varied factors similar to their degree of expertise, the size and type of shoppers they serve, and the state of the stock market.

The NYSE has physically decreased its space, and more stockbrokers are allowed to do business from home. Most trades are made online, rather than auction-style on the trading room ground. Most states also require brokers to pass the Collection sixty three, or the Uniform Securities State Legislation Examination.

The job tends to be very competitive, since one broker can help a consumer buy inventory as easily as another one can. Between 2022 and 2032, employment of securities, commodities, and monetary services agents is projected to grow 7%, in accordance with the united states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S), which is quicker than the common for all occupations. The average wage for a stockbroker in the U.S. is $160,450 as of April 24, 2024, according to Salary.com.
